H. Sadeghi is a scholar working on Nuclear and High Energy Physics, Atomic and Molecular Physics, and Optics and Biomedical Engineering. According to data from OpenAlex, H. Sadeghi has authored 116 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 46 papers in Nuclear and High Energy Physics, 37 papers in Atomic and Molecular Physics, and Optics and 16 papers in Biomedical Engineering. Recurrent topics in H. Sadeghi's work include Nuclear physics research studies (45 papers), Atomic and Molecular Physics (25 papers) and Quantum Chromodynamics and Particle Interactions (23 papers). H. Sadeghi is often cited by papers focused on Nuclear physics research studies (45 papers), Atomic and Molecular Physics (25 papers) and Quantum Chromodynamics and Particle Interactions (23 papers). H. Sadeghi collaborates with scholars based in Iran, Kyrgyzstan and Netherlands. H. Sadeghi's co-authors include D.D. Ganji, S.S. Ghadikolaei, Kh. Hosseinzadeh, Katelyn N. Brinegar, Jeroen Leijten, Ali Khademhosseini, João Ribas, Mohammad Hossein Keshavarz, Amir Manbachi and Lino Ferreira and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Applied Physics and Journal of Hazardous Materials.
